-7m+4< -45 for solving an inequality
worty [1.4K]

Solving the inequality -7m+4< -45 we get m>7

Step-by-step explanation:

We need to solve the inequality: -7m+4< -45

Solving:

-7m+4< -45

Adding -4 on both sides:

-7m+4-4< -45-4

-7m< -49

Divide both sides by -7 and reverse the inequality:

\frac{-7m}{-7}>\frac{-49}{-7}

m>7

So, solving the inequality -7m+4< -45 we get m>7

The ratio 36:60 is equivalent to what other ratio
Dmitrij [34]

Answer:

3:5

Step-by-step explanation:

Rewrite this as a fraction to see easier:

\frac{36}{60}

You can divide both numbers by 12, the GCF:

\frac{36}{60}= \frac{3}{5}

Rewrite as a ratio:

3:5
